Coloring tips: How to color Garfield Christmas Feast Scene coloring page well?
For coloring Garfield, you can use bright orange for his fur and white for the stripes on his back. His plate can be colored in bright colors to symbolize delicious food. Use green for the Christmas tree and add colorful decorations like red and gold baubles. The gifts can be colored in various bright colors, like blue or red, to make the scene pop. Remember to use different shades to give depth, especially on the tablecloth and the tree.
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for Garfield Christmas Feast Scene coloring page?
1. Garfield's Fur: Achieving a smooth and even shade of orange can be tricky. It requires practice to blend colors correctly.
2. Christmas Tree Details: The tree has many ornaments, which can be difficult to color neatly. Children may find it hard to stay inside the lines.
3. Shadows: Adding shadows under Garfield and the gifts can be challenging. It requires understanding how light works.
4. Tablecloth Patterns: If the tablecloth has patterns, coloring them without going outside the lines can be tough.
5. Gift Design: Each gift can have unique designs. Coloring them differently requires planning and creativity.
